The effects of the menstrual cycle (MC) on exercise metabolism and performance are equivocal. PURPOSE: To investigate whether the MC impacted submaximal exercise oxygen consumption (VO2) and Critical Power (CP) in recreationally active, eumenorrheic females. METHODS: Eight eumenorrheic females (Age: 33±8 y, VO2max: 36.9±3.8 ml/kg/min) completed fasted exercise testing in 3 distinct phases of the MC (early follicular, late follicular, and mid luteal). MC phase was determined using calendar-based counting, ovulation test strips, and confirmed via serum hormones (estrogen and progesterone). Endothelial dysfunction is characterized by the unbalance between vasodilatory and vasoconstrictor mechanisms. Furthermore, this is recognized as the initial step to developing cardiovascular disease. Exercise plays an important role in both cardiac rehabilitation and cardiovascular risk prevention. However, some new exercise modalities, such as high-intensity interval training (HIIT), are becoming more popular, and limited information about their effect on the endothelium is available. PURPOSE: to determine what volume of HIIT will improve endothelial function than continuous moderate exercise intensity. According to the 2023 AHA Heart Disease and Stroke Statistics update, Hispanics exhibit the highest prevalence of type II diabetes (men: 14.5%, women 12.3%) compared to non-Hispanic White (NHW men: 11.5%, women 7.7%) and Non-Hispanic Black (men: 11.8%, women 13.3%). Endothelial dysfunction is a precursor to cardiovascular diseases including type II diabetes; however, it remains unknown whether healthy asymptomatic Hispanic adults present a reduced endothelial function before the onset of cardiovascular symptoms. Family history of hypertension (FHH), being an unmodifiable risk factor, increases probability of developing hypertension and other cardiovascular diseases. The prevalence of hypertension in Hispanic/Latino (H/La) males is 50.3%, while it is 48.9% in non-Hispanic white (NHW) males and 57.5% in non-Hispanic black (NHB) males. Among adolescents aged 8 to 17, H/La youth has the highest incidence of hypertension as compared to all other races. It is evident that young normotensive adults with positive family history of hypertension (+FHH) exhibit exaggerated exercise pressor response. Chronic kidney disease (CKD) is a gradual loss of renal filtration and has been shown to be associated with lower levels of vitamin D (Vit-D). Vit-D is highly synthesized in the kidneys and is linked to multiple health conditions. Aerobic exercise of differing intensity and modality has shown potential in acutely improving Vit-D concentration in healthy and diseased populations. Purpose: To determine the influence of acute bouts of high-intensity interval exercise (HIIE) and steady-state exercise (SSE) on Vit-D concentrations in individuals with moderate stages of CKD. Vitamin D (VD) deficiency is one of the most common deficiencies in the world due to various factors (e.g., lack of sun exposure, dietary considerations). Currently the utilization of exercise may act as an intervention for VD deficiencies to promote increases in VD concentrations in healthy populations. This could largely be due to the loss of calcium from aerobic exercise (AE), leading to a hormonal response [(e.g., parathyroid hormone (PTH)] and the activation of cytochrome’s (e.g., CYP2R1, CYP27B1) responsible for the regulation of VD. Firefighters (FF) and law enforcement officers (LEO) have heightened cardiovascular disease (CVD) risk due to the stressful nature of their occupations. Data suggest that 45% of on-duty FF fatalities are related to CVD, while LEO have a 1.7 times higher CVD prevalence compared to the general public. To our knowledge, studies comparing FF to LEO, in terms of CVD risk factors, have not been published. This information is necessary to better understand differences in occupational disease risk, as well as to help bridge the gap between stress and CVD markers.
